Geobag dewatering, a groundbreaking technique in the realm of environmental engineering, offers an innovative solution to manage sediment, sludge, and wastewater effectively. With its eco-friendly approach and versatile applications, geobag dewatering has emerged as a sustainable and efficient method in various industries, ranging from construction and mining to municipal wastewater treatment.Geobag dewatering involves the utilization of geotextile bags or containers filled with sediment-laden water. These specialized bags are engineered with permeable materials that allow water to pass through while retaining solids inside. The process begins by pumping the contaminated water into the geobags, where the sediment settles, and the water gradually drains out. As the water seeps through the geotextile fabric, it leaves behind solid particles, resulting in clean water that can either be safely discharged or reused.One of the primary advantages of geobag dewatering lies in its versatility. It effectively addresses various sediment-related challenges encountered in different industries. In construction, geobag dewatering proves invaluable in managing runoff water from sites, preventing soil erosion, and facilitating efficient disposal of excess sediment. Similarly, in mining operations, these techniques aid in the treatment of mine tailings, reducing environmental impact by containing harmful substances.Municipalities also benefit significantly from geobag dewatering systems in wastewater treatment plants. These systems help in separating sludge from water, enabling the treatment of larger volumes of wastewater efficiently. Moreover, the dewatered sludge can be further processed for safe disposal or repurposing, contributing to sustainable waste management practices.The environmental benefits of geobag dewatering are noteworthy. By effectively controlling sediment and pollutants, this technique minimizes the risk of water contamination, preserving local ecosystems and biodiversity.
